面向对象编程中的数学对偶是指在面向对象编程语言中,对象和类之间的关系可以通过数学中的一些概念进行类比和理解。在面向对象编程中,对象和类之间的关系可以通过数学中的一对一、一对多和多对多关系进行类比和理解。
具体来说,对象可以被看作是数学中的一个点,而类可以被看作是一个集合。对象和类之间的关系可以被看作是集合与点之间的关系。在数学中,一个集合可以包含多个点,而一个点只能属于一个集合。因此,一个类可以包含多个对象,而一个对象只能属于一个类。
此外,对象和类之间的关系还可以通过数学中的函数进行类比和理解。在面向对象编程中,对象和类之间的关系可以被看作是函数的定义域和值域之间的关系。具体来说,对象可以被看作是函数的定义域中的一个元素,而类可以被看作是函数的值域中的一个元素。因此,对象和类之间的关系可以被看作是一对一、一对多和多对多关系。
总之,面向对象编程中的数学对偶是一种非常有用的思维方式,可以帮助程序员更好地理解和设计面向对象编程语言中的对象和类之间的关系。
领取专属 10元无门槛券
手把手带您无忧上云